Two auctions within the ServNet family have recently made leadership announcements, as Pittsburgh Auto Auction appointed a chief financial officer and Plaza Auto Auction of Iowa named a sales manager.

Starting with Pittsburgh, the auction’s chief executive officer Dave Angelicchio announced that Shelley (Angelicchio) Walker has taken on the CFO role, replacing Bob Bilinsk.

Bilinsk retired after more than 31 years with the auction.

“I am very happy that Shelly has decided to join the family business,” said Angelicchio. “We are extremely fortunate to have someone with her knowledge and experience to fill this vital role in our company.

“I also want to congratulate Bob on his retirement and thank him for his many years of dedicated service to Pittsburgh Auto Auction,” he added.

Over at Plaza Auto Auction, owner Mark Greb announced that Becky McGinty has been appointed sales manager. She has been with the auction since 1982 and joined the sales department in 2008.

Her first role at the auction was working at the dealer registration desk. Since then, she has served as a title clerk, worked in fleet/lease administration and served in the sales department.
